Alexis Lebrun Wins at WTT Star Contender São José dos Campos: Day 2 Replay

French table tennis star Alexis Lebrun advanced smoothly to the second round of the WTT Star Contender São José dos Campos tournament, defeating Slovakia’s Lubomir Pistej in straight games. Lebrun controlled the pace from the opening exchange, securing a dominant win on the international circuit.

Alexis Lebrun Controls Opening Match Against Lubomir Pistej

Entering the WTT Star Contender event in São José dos Campos, Brazil, Alexis Lebrun faced off against veteran Slovak competitor Lubomir Pistej. According to tournament results, Lebrun managed the tactical exchanges with precision, preventing his opponent from establishing any rhythm. The French competitor relied on his trademark aggressive forehand loops and quick transition play to dismantle Pistej’s defensive setup.

Pistej, known for his experience on the World Table Tennis circuit, struggled to counter the speed and heavy spin generated by Lebrun. The straightforward victory preserves Lebrun’s energy as he navigates a competitive international bracket in South America.

Tournament Context at WTT Star Contender São José dos Campos

The WTT Star Contender stop in São José dos Campos attracts top-tier paddlers seeking vital ranking points and prize money on the global circuit. For Lebrun, maintaining momentum in early-round matches remains essential for seeding purposes in later stages of high-tier WTT events.

International competitions in Brazil offer unique logistical and environmental adjustments for European athletes, requiring quick adaptation to local venue conditions and humidity levels. Lebrun’s ability to close out Pistej without dropping a game highlights his current competitive form.
